Controversial Former Minister to Receive Official Funeral Tuesday in Belize City

Controversial Former Minister to Receive Official Funeral Tuesday in Belize City

As we reported on Friday, former Belize Rural Central Area Representative Ralph Fonseca, known for his influential and often controversial role in national affairs, passed away early Friday morning after a long battle with illness. He was seventy-five. Today, People’s United Party Chairman Henry Charles Usher confirmed that Fonseca’s official funeral will take place tomorrow in Belize City. The ceremony is expected to draw current and former political leaders, supporters, and those who followed his decades-long career.

Henry Charles Usher, P.U.P. Chairman

“He’s having an official funeral as a former member of Cabinet, former minister, and elected representative of the house. That official funeral is going to be tomorrow at Divine Mercy Church at two p.m., followed by interment at the Lord Ridge Cemetery.”
